Her engaging personality and deep knowledge of music made her a natural for television. She has served as a judge on several long-running musical reality shows, most notably on ETV, a legendary show that was originally hosted by S. P. Balasubrahmanyam. She has also hosted popular shows like Navaragam , Jhummandi Naadam , and Saptasvaralu on various channels. Her poise and grace were also evident when she was chosen to anchor the prestigious Amaravati foundation-laying ceremony in 2015.

Sunitha Upadrasta is one of the most celebrated playback singers and dubbing artists in the Telugu film industry. With a career spanning over three decades, her soulful voice and exceptional dubbing skills have left an indelible mark on South Indian cinema. Sunitha is one of the most awarded artists in the Telugu film industry. Nandi Awards: Won 9 times for excellence in singing and dubbing.
